As a multi-channel retailer and now in our third decade on the high street, we are seeking a Retail Sales Assistant to join our Chesterfield team. You must be aged 18 or above. The store is near the village of Barlborough, which is located outside the town of Chesterfield.
Who are Cotton Traders? CT for short, we are a clothing retailer established in 1987 by England rugby captains and legends Fran Cotton and Steve Smith. Supported by a growing online and offline (catalogue) presence, we have 80 stores nationwide in England, Scotland and Wales and employ 800 people across the country. How to prepare for a job interview at Cotton Traders
✨Know the Brand
Before your interview, take some time to research Cotton Traders. Understand their history, values, and what makes them unique in the retail space.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the company.
✨Show Your Enthusiasm
As a Retail Sales Assistant, attitude is everything! Be sure to convey your passion for customer service during the interview. Share examples of how you've gone above and beyond for customers in the past, as this aligns perfectly with what they’re looking for.
✨Prepare for Common Questions
Think about common interview questions related to retail, such as how you handle difficult customers or how you work in a team. Practising your responses can help you feel more confident and articulate during the actual interview.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team culture, training opportunities, or what success looks like in the role. This shows that you’re engaged and serious about the position.
